HYDE PARK — Real estate experts will separate reality from the reality shows at a homes expo on Saturday in South Shore.

The South Side Expo will offer 10 workshops helping confused homeowners who struggling to understand why reality shows make homeownership so easy for rookies.

The event from 10 a.m. to 4 p.m. at the South Shore International College Prep, 1955 E. 75th St., brings together homeowners with experts on mortgages, contractors, insurance and other services.

RE/MAX agents Warren and LaShawn Davis’ nonprofit Chicago Expo has organized a full day of workshops on buying foreclosed properties, flipping property and interior design makeovers.
